Apex International awards contract to start oil and gas exploration in North AfricaMonday, 28 May 2018 06:51This is line with Apex’s aim to explore more oilfields in the region. The two concession agreements consist of 1.7mn acres encompassing the West Badr el Din (4,180 sq km) and South East Meleiha (2,535 sq km) concessions, located in the prolific Abu Gharadig Basin in Egypt's Western Desert. The oil and gas potential in North Africa, particularly in Egypt, is very attractive to explore more oilfields. Recently, Egypt is advancing towards to reshaping it oil and gas scenarios. This follows with the European Bank for Reconstruction and Development’s (EBRD) US$200mn loan to modernise the North African country’s oil refinery and SDX’s significant natural gas discovery in Egypt.
